Hereditary Occurrence of Deep Excavations of the Optic Nerve with Best´s RetinalDystrophy

Overview

The authors present a pedigree where in three generations in male members deepexcavations of the optic discs along with Best´s disease of the centres in a variableform were recorded.The heredity is autosomal dominant. Retinal changes conditioned by defects ofthe pigmented epithelium reduce vision to a maximum of 6/60. The anomaly isassociated with a pathological EOG record and normal ERG response. The obser-vation is a contribution to discussions in the literature about the hereditarycharacter of excavations of the optic nerve.

Key words:
deep excavations of the optic disc, Best´s dystrophy, heredity
